# Fixture: compressed telemetry payloads for the Glintwave collector.
# Each sample below was captured from a Norvane-7 sensor rig and then
# run through our zstd wrapper at level 9, so the byte counts the support
# team sees in tickets should match these exactly. If a customer reports
# payload sizes drifting more than 3%, check whether their agent is still
# on the legacy gzip path before escalating. Replaying these fixtures
# against the staging collector requires authentication, so use the
# token below.

session JWT of yawep-yawep = eyJhbGciOiJIUzI1NiIsInR5cCI6IkpXVCJ9.eyJzdWIiOiI3pWF3_In0.aXYsHiog

Blocking on one thing: the Maploom autocomplete widget fires a lookup on every keystroke with no debounce, which hammers the geocoder and makes suggestions flicker. Add a debounce and a minimum query length before dispatch, and cap in-flight requests so slow responses can't reorder the dropdown. Also cache recent prefixes locally; the eviction policy matters more than size here. Everything should be configurable, not inlined, so staging and prod can diverge. The values I'd start with are these.

tuning table, yajog-yahof:
BUDGETS = {
    "lamvan": 303,
    "wenox": 460,
    "fenvan": 525,
}

Onboarding: Date Localization in Pressvane

All user-facing dates in Pressvane flow through the Calvetta formatting service, which maps locale codes to regional patterns. Never hand-format dates in templates; the service handles ordering, separators, and calendar variants. Locally, run the Calvetta stub with the fixtures in the repo. To query the staging Calvetta instance while testing, authenticate with the key that follows.

service key, fawip-bajef: kto11_Qt5wZK9vdNC